Apparently afraid to ride horses for a film promotion, Farhan Akhtar and Co let the younger actors take the reins

Often actors go the extra mile to find out newer and more innovative ways to promote their upcoming films. But looks like this crop of 'senior' actors actually let the 'juniors' in the team get into the driver's seat, almost literally.

Initially, actor-producer Farhan Akhtar and co-producer Ritesh Sidhwani apparently had agreed to gallop into the promotional venue on horses, to add a dose of drama to the event.

However, sources say at the last minute they backed out because they were scared! Instead they asked the younger actors to take over the reins and instead chose to ride to the venue on bicycles.

Since the story revolves around a group of guys trying to get admission into a college, a grand music launch was arranged at the Atma Ram Sanatan Dharma College in Delhi.

`This particular decision was taken as the first shot in the promo shows the two boys enter the college on horses! Not only the two producers, even writer-director Mrigdeep Lamba was supposed to reach the venue like knights but none of that happened. Perhaps they developed cold feet at the last moment, ` says a source present at the location.


Finally, the makers took a call that the film's younger cast would ride the horses whereas Ritesh, Farhan and Mrigdeep would be coming on their two-wheeler.

Adds the informer, `They thought why not let the newcomers soak in the limelight. Besides, the trio wasn't very comfortable with the idea of horse riding and that too in a packed venue like a campus. Interestingly, the four actors -- Pulkit Samrat, Ali Faisal, Manjot Singh and Varun Sharma -- were more than happy and made a filmi entry to dhol beats playing in the background. `
